from P4K:
Le Tigre aren't the only P4k-friendly acts working with Aguilera on her new LP-- Goldfrapp, Ladytron, M.I.A., and Santigold have clocked in studio time with the singer for potential Bionic tracks, too. Gossip blogs claim the new album is set for release in April with first single "Glam" to hit in the coming weeks.
